Hilton revealed recently that it has signed a major global deal with concert organiser Live Nation. It will form the backbone of ‘Hilton @ Play’, a new Hilton website which you can find here.
‘Hilton @ Play’ will be offering general concert tickets, VIP packages, ‘meet and greet’ events and exclusive small-scale gigs to Hilton HHonors members as new redemption options. It is clearly an attempt to copy the Starwood ‘SPG Moments’ scheme.
To give Hilton credit, this is a very impressive commercial deal for them.
Live Nation will start to advertise nearby Hilton properties to people booking concert tickets on its website and will also use Hilton properties for their employees and participants in their wholly-owned shows.
To launch the partnership, a small number of Hilton Hotels around the world will be holding concerts, starting with Conrad New York this month.
At the moment there are no UK events on the site but I would expect this to change over the next month or so. An event in Rome just closed, for example, and someone paid 860,000 Hilton points for a package to the Barcelona Grand Prix.
Worth bookmarking. My biggest gripe is that you cannot search the site by country which seems a massive weakness.
